Born in Melrose Park and spent many hours meeting and eating breakfast at Harlo. Lots of business was done there. Burgers are the best and fries like you ask, soft and soggy to burnt. Service and the crowd are always friendly. Don't let the prices fool you... Very good eating for a reasonable price. Neat and clean. I always liked that I can watch my food being cooked. Hope the Harlo stays forever!

I've been going to Harlo since I was a kid. I have since moved to Texas... The Harlo sign is my screen saver on my computer at work (if that says anything about how much I miss the place). Every time go back home, I make sure I have the triple bypass (my own creation). Ham, bacon, sausage, eggs and extra cheese... all on white toast! Order a side of EXTRA CRISPY hash browns on the side. Oh wait.. O.K. whew! It was just a small heart attack. You'll love the place!

If you truly want an experience in sociology, head to the Harlo Grill. The burgers are a bit greasy, but you can sit at the counter and have it laid in front of you on a sheet of wax paper.
Great old greasy spoon grill.
